Pressure Transducer Boasts Of 10 Times Improvement In Accuracy

Nov. 1, 1998

Well-suited for situations requiring high precision, reliability and economy, Series 30X transducer offers active compensation for non-linearity and thermal errors. Increasing overall accuracy by a factor of 10 compared with previous versions, the transducer provides standard analog outputs, including voltage and current loop versions with a compensated temperature range of -10°C to 80°C with an operating temperature range of -54°C to 105°C. The transducers come with a traceable calibration card that specifies input/output conditions and actual data reflecting the unit's performance.
